Caroline's Review
⭐⭐⭐⭐

This was such a lovely second-chance romance.

"I forget everything except the fact that I used to love this man with my whole heart. And I've never loved anyone the same way since."

Remi Cooper is a successful publicist. She fought her way hard to get to where she is today, at the cost of her personal life. When her work brings her face to face with her ex-fiance of twelve years ago, it churns up lots of things for her and makes her question what she wants out of life.

"I was more miserable without you than I ever thought I was with you."

Alastair Wells is not the same man he was when he broke their engagement - his life is pretty different these days. At first unfriendly and unwelcoming, he warms up to Remi pretty quickly. A recluse by nature, he accepts her help and ideas to catapult his career to a different level. However, when things heat up again between them, will his new-found level of fame be the cause of more heartbreak?

"In his gaze I see the past. The present. The future. All of the heartbreak. All of the love. All of the possibility."

I really enjoyed Remi and Alastair's romance. I loved their tentative steps towards friendship and the obvious chemistry and connection between them. I loved that Alastair was so willing for more between them, no matter the obstacles. Remi is a workaholic but her re-connection with Alastair is the catalyst for a reevaluation of her life. 

I've never read this author before but I enjoyed her fluid style and the steady rhythm of her words. The characters were well-drawn and engaging. The story was a little bit angsty but heartwarming. Will definitely read more of her books.

Author Bio


Brenda is a displaced New Yorker living in the English countryside. She’s lived in the UK long enough to gain dual citizenship, but still doesn’t understand Celsius. However, she has learned the appropriate use of the word “pants”. And how to order a proper bacon bap/barm/buttie. Because, well, bacon.

Brenda writes contemporary romance to make you giggle and swoon. When she’s not writing, she enjoys hiking, running and reading. In theory, she also enjoys cooking, but it’s more that she enjoys eating and, try as she might, she can’t live on Doritos alone.
